The Problem
Generally it’s good if pipelines don’t move, but pipes can vibrate from just internal flow. When a long-dormant cross-over pipe was about to be used, the client needed to make sure that vibration levels would be acceptable.
Our Approach
We created a dynamic, harmonic finite element model of the crossover system to simulate operational stresses and predict a fatigue life. Dynamic pressure excitation was taken from measured vibration data, in conjunction with a study of excitation sources.
The Results
The study showed that the procedure could be done without excessive stress. Subsequently, the customer performed the operation in full safety.
